Canadian Imperial Bank of Commerce (TSE:CM) Hits New 1-Year High - Still a Buy?

Canadian Imperial Bank of Commerce logo with Financial Services background

Canadian Imperial Bank of Commerce (TSE:CM - Get Free Report) NYSE: CM shares hit a new 52-week high during mid-day trading on Wednesday . The company traded as high as C$101.60 and last traded at C$101.09, with a volume of 552999 shares traded. The stock had previously closed at C$101.22.

Wall Street Analysts Forecast Growth

CM has been the subject of a number of analyst reports. Canaccord Genuity Group set a C$96.00 price target on Canadian Imperial Bank of Commerce and gave the stock a "hold" rating in a research report on Tuesday, June 24th. National Bankshares set a C$95.00 price target on Canadian Imperial Bank of Commerce and gave the stock an "outperform" rating in a research report on Thursday, May 22nd. National Bank Financial downgraded Canadian Imperial Bank of Commerce from an "outperform" rating to a "sector perform" rating in a research report on Thursday, May 29th. Barclays raised their price target on Canadian Imperial Bank of Commerce from C$90.00 to C$94.00 and gave the stock an "underperform" rating in a research report on Monday, June 9th. Finally, Jefferies Financial Group downgraded Canadian Imperial Bank of Commerce from a "buy" rating to a "hold" rating and lowered their price target for the stock from C$100.00 to C$89.00 in a research report on Monday, April 21st. One equities research analyst has rated the stock with a sell rating, three have given a hold rating, seven have issued a buy rating and one has issued a strong buy rating to the company. According to data from MarketBeat.com, the company currently has a consensus rating of "Moderate Buy" and a consensus target price of C$96.23.

Canadian Imperial Bank of Commerce Stock Performance

The firm has a market capitalization of C$94.90 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 13.40, a P/E/G ratio of 3.03 and a beta of 1.12. The company has a 50 day moving average price of C$96.06 and a two-hundred day moving average price of C$89.26.

Canadian Imperial Bank of Commerce Dividend Announcement

The company also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Monday, July 28th. Investors of record on Monday, July 28th will be paid a $0.97 dividend. This represents a $3.88 annualized dividend and a yield of 3.82%. The ex-dividend date is Friday, June 27th. Canadian Imperial Bank of Commerce's dividend payout ratio is currently 47.55%.

Insider Transactions at Canadian Imperial Bank of Commerce

In related news, Senior Officer Shawn Beber sold 9,107 shares of the stock in a transaction on Friday, June 6th. The stock was sold at an average price of C$94.28, for a total value of C$858,567.89. Also, Senior Officer Christina Charlotte Kramer sold 43,490 shares of the stock in a transaction on Tuesday, June 3rd. The shares were sold at an average price of C$93.07, for a total value of C$4,047,614.30. Insiders sold a total of 105,837 shares of company stock valued at $9,903,590 in the last 90 days. 0.02% of the stock is owned by company insiders.

Canadian Imperial Bank of Commerce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Canadian Imperial Bank of Commerce is Canada's fifth- largest bank, operating three business segments: retail and business banking, wealth management, and capital markets. It serves approximately 11 million personal banking and business customers, primarily in Canada.
